How much do part time temp j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 7, 2026, the average hourly pay for part time temp in Florida is $12.93,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$10.77 and $14.38 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time temp,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Part Time Temp, you need flexibility, adaptability, and a general proficiency in workplace tasks, often supported by a high school diploma or relevant experience. Familiarity with office software like Microsoft Office Suite or Google Workspace and basic administrative systems is commonly required. Strong communication, reliability, and the ability to quickly learn new procedures help temps stand out in diverse environments. These skills ensure that temporary staff can efficiently support organizations, adapt to changing assignments, and maintain productivity with minimal supervision.

What types of projects and tasks are commonly assigned to part time temp employees, and how do these assignments vary by industry?

Part-time temp employees are typically brought in to support short-term projects, fill in during staff shortages, or help during peak workload periods. Depending on the industry, tasks may range from administrative support (such as data entry, scheduling, or customer service) in offices to assisting with inventory, packaging, or basic production in warehouses or retail settings. Assignments are often designed to be manageable within a limited time frame and may change week-to-week based on the employer's immediate needs, offering variety but also requiring adaptability. Temporary roles can provide valuable exposure to different work environments and teams, helping you build skills and expand your professional network.

Part Time Temp roles are typically short-term, flexible assignments often arranged through staffing agencies, with minimal credentials required. Part Time Clerks usually work in ongoing, part-time positions within offices or retail environments, often requiring basic office skills. Both serve different employment needs but share a focus on part-time work in administrative or support roles.

What is a part time temp?

A part time temp is an employee hired to work on a temporary basis with part-time hours, typically less than 35 hours per week. These positions are often used to fill in for regular staff during busy periods, special projects, or employee absences. Part time temps may work for a few days, weeks, or months, depending on the employer’s needs. They are usually employed through staffing agencies or directly by companies and may not receive the same benefits as full-time permanent employees.
